Welcome to the Midwest Gateway Chapter of INCOSE. We are based in the St Louis region, from Rolla to the Metro East. The Midwest Gateway Chapter of INCOSE was founded in St. Louis in 1992. Over the years we've hosted the INCOSE Symposium and the Conference on Systems Engineering Research (CSER), and been the home chapter of national and regional INCOSE leaders.

Finger Lakes Chapter presents "An Introduction to Architecture" Tutorial by Rolf Siegers, INCOSE Architecture WG Co-chair

Teresa Froncek
[email protected]

This tutorial will provide attendees with an overview of key elements of the architecture discipline. There will be two 2-hour sessions for a total of 4 hours. Topics covered will include:

  • Terminology/Definitions
  • Synergies across software, system, and enterprise architecture
  • Process: developing, documenting, assessing, and governing architectures
  • Architecture standards (e.g., 42010/20/30) and frameworks (DoDAF, TOGAF, UAF, etc.)
  • Role and skills of the architect
  • Architecture professional organizations
  • Architecture credentials (certifications and certificates)
  • Learning more about architecture

INSTRUCTOR: Rolf Siegers is an Engineering Fellow and Raytheon Technologies (RTX) Certified Architect. He leads the RTX Mission Architecture Program and the RTX Technology Networks organization.
The Mission Architecture Program is a group of enterprise-wide initiatives to establish and evolve software, system, and enterprise architecture expertise across the company. Its scope includes architecture process, training and certification, governance, assessment, reference architectures, tools, and collaboration with government, industry, academia, and standards organizations.
The Technology Networks and their 100+ Technology Interest Groups span the United States, Australia, and the United Kingdom. The organization includes over 45,000 employee memberships spanning systems engineering and architecture, information systems and computing, RF systems, electro-optical systems, mechanical, materials & structures, and manufacturing.

The Midwest Gateway Chapter of INCOSE was founded in St. Louis in 1992. Over the years we've hosted the INCOSE Symposium and the Conference on Systems Engineering Research (CSER), and been the home chapter of national and regional INCOSE leaders. Many of our members are engaged in defense, biotech, connected devices, and academia. Most members are located in St. Louis and the surrounding area (from Missouri S&T in Rolla to Scott Air Force Base in the Metro East), but all are welcome to affiliate with us.
